Devan Allen McGranahan,Jay P Angerer Devan Allen McGranahan
There is growing interest in diversifying human-managed fire regimes. In many North American grasslands, late growing season burns re-introduce fire to periods most prone to lightning-driven fire prior to wildfire suppression policies....We report here on restoring summer fire in central North Dakota, USA, from a research project in which summer burns were only completed in two out of four years for which summer burns were planned....We use remotely-sensed imagery and local weather data to assess whether fuel or weather conditions limited burning in the summer, and to compare fire environmental conditions and subsequent burn severity across prescribed burns conducted in the spring and summer....Overall, we found little evidence that being able to complete summer burns was anomalous, and conclude that it is reasonable for managers to incorporate late growing season fire into prescribed fire programs with the caveat that some summers will simply be too wet and/or too green to burn.

Kundan Lal Shrestha,Aakriti Gyawali,Sabina Gyawali et al. Kundan Lal Shrestha et al.
Along with the simulation in the WRF-Chem model, we used Sentinel-5P satellite data for analyzing pollutants during excessive fire events in Nepal. Comparison was done between the concentration obtained from numerical modeling with the satellite observation....Simulation was done for December 2021 using the Fire Inventory from NCAR (FINN) fire emissions dataset, and other anthropogenic emission data. Maximum fire contribution in December 2020 was about 120% increase in NO2, 48% in PM2.5, 35% in PM10, 32% in CO, 28% in SO2, and 17.5% in NH3....Winter season (November-February) accounted for a low fire count whereas the pre-monsoon season (March-April) accounted for a high fire count in Nepal....Wildfire contributed to high levels of pollution during March and April 2021 as it accounted for high fire counts where maximum UV-AAI was 0.8315, and CO and NO2 column number density were 0.067 mol m-2 and 4.1204 × 10-5μmol m-2 respectively.
